logo

Output e85d18376b38baf67589fe725656ddf486fbb6046da3271b662fbfb86f34960e:0

value
40754817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1133264a37d42f742e837a3116960a06379a90b OP_EQUAL
address
3KHuLPRX9FLsy55HEoeJBe6dWqR4CfYxS7
transaction
e85d18376b38baf67589fe725656ddf486fbb6046da3271b662fbfb86f34960e